Forrest City, Arkansas: A Hidden Treasure in the Heart of the United States

Located in St. Francis County, Arkansas, Forrest City is a hidden gem in the heart of the United States. Founded in 1870, this small but vibrant city is rich in history, culture, and natural beauty, making it an ideal tourist destination for those seeking a unique and authentic experience.

History and Culture

Forrest City is named after Nathan Bedford Forrest, a Confederate general and the first Grand Wizard of the Ku Klux Klan. Despite its controversial past, the city has worked hard to overcome its history and has become a place of diversity and acceptance. The St. Francis County History Museum is a must-visit for visitors interested in learning more about local history.

Natural Attractions

Forrest City is surrounded by natural beauty. Village Creek State Park, located just a few miles from the city, offers over 7,000 acres of forests, lakes, and hiking trails. Visitors can enjoy a variety of outdoor activities, such as hiking, biking, fishing, and camping. Additionally, the park is home to a wide variety of wildlife, making it an ideal place for bird watching and nature photography.

Local Cuisine

The cuisine of Forrest City is as diverse as its population. Visitors can enjoy a variety of local dishes, from traditional southern barbecue to authentic Mexican cuisine. In addition, the city hosts several food festivals throughout the year, where visitors can sample a variety of local and regional dishes.

Events and Festivals

Forrest City is known for its festivals and community events. The Strawberry Festival, held every May, is one of the city's most popular events. This festival celebrates the city's rich agricultural history and offers a variety of activities for the whole family, including a parade, cooking contests, live music, and, of course, fresh strawberries. Other popular events include the St. Francis County Blues Festival and the Forrest City Fall Festival.

Gastronomic Products of Forrest City

  • Arkansas Style Barbecue

    Forrest City, located in the state of Arkansas, is known for its Arkansas style barbecue. This type of barbecue is characterized by its tomato and vinegar-based sauce, which is used to marinate and season the meat before grilling. The meat, which is usually pork, is slowly cooked over low heat to make it tender and juicy.

  • Traditional Southern Food

    Forrest City also offers a variety of traditional southern food dishes. Among the most popular are collard greens, fried chicken, gumbo, and cornbread. These dishes are characterized by their rich and comforting flavor, and are a testament to the rich culinary tradition of the southern United States.

  • Pecan Pies

    Arkansas is famous for its pecans, and Forrest City is no exception. Pecan pies are a popular dessert in the area, made with fresh pecans and a sweet mixture of eggs, sugar, and butter. This dessert is a real treat for sweet lovers and is an excellent way to end a meal.

Sporting Activities in Forrest City

Golf

Forrest City is home to the Forrest City Country Club, a 9-hole golf course that offers a challenging experience for golfers of all levels.

Fishing

The nearby St. Francis River is a popular spot for fishing. Visitors can expect to catch a variety of fish, including catfish and bass.

Hunting

The region around Forrest City is known for its duck and deer hunting. There are several local companies that offer guided hunting tours.

Hiking

Village Creek State Park, located just a few miles from Forrest City, offers over 30 kilometers of trails for walking and biking.

Cycling

Village Creek State Park is also a popular spot for mountain biking, with trails that vary in difficulty from beginner to advanced.
